前言
Python作为非常火的开发语言,作为一个java程序员最近也不能“免俗”的开始学习Python知识。为了巩固自己所学习的知识与加强记忆,开了这个系列的总结“Java2Python基础版”,希望能对他人起到一定的帮助作用。这个系列将以简洁为主,贵在精不在多(其实是懒)
需知:
本系列基于Python3
系列的名称都叫Java2Python,所以是从一个java程序员的视角去学习和看待Python的,所以这不是一个面向纯小白的系列文章
系列文章中我尽量说明java和Python之间的区别
Python简介
“Python是一种广泛使用的高级编程语言,属于通用型编程语言,由Guido van Rossum创造,第一版发布于1991年。可以视为改良的LISP。作为一种解释型语言,Python的设计哲学强调代码的可读性和简洁的语法。相比于C++或Java,Python让开发者能够用更少的代码表达想法。不管是小型还是大型程序,该语言都视图让程序的结构清晰明了。”以上摘自维基百科。
翻译成大白话就是,用Python写代码会更简洁,可读性更高。
Python2.x和3.x的区别
Python3是对Python2的一次较大升级,为了不带入过多的“累赘”,Python3在设计的时候没有考虑向下兼容,所以许多针对Python早期版本的程序都无法再Python3上执行。但是Python3是以后的方向,所以为了一步到位个人推荐学习Python3,而且现在(2018年12月15日)Python3已经到3.7.1版本了。
搭建Python3环境
Python3可以跨平台使用,这点与java相似,为啥说相似而不是一致?是因为Python跨平台主要是源码跨平台,编译之后不一定能跨平台,而Java是通过在程序代码和操作系统之间增加了一层JVM而实现的跨平台。
Windows安装
去https://www.python.org/downloads/下载你想安装的Python的安装包
点击安装包,根据自己的需要进行一定的配置。注意:记得在“下一步”过程中勾选“Add Python 3.7 to PATH”,也就是将Python加入环境变量中,为了之后在CMD中敲Python可以识别。若没有勾选则并且想要在CMD中随时使用Python,则需自己手动配置环境变量
进入CMD,输入Python,出现以下输出则为安装成功。
Linux安装(Ubuntu为例)
Linux上安装Python的方式比较多:
方式一:下载源码,编译安装
1.打开https://www.python.org/downloads/source/
下载符合Linux版本的源码压缩包
下载并解压该压缩包
tar xfz Python-3.7.1.tgz
编译安装
进入Python解压后的文件夹cdpython3.7/
编译Python sudo make
执行安装sudo makeinstall
方式二:通过apt-get的方式
1. sudo apt-get update
2. sudo apt-get install python3.7
领取 专属20元代金券
Get大咖技术交流圈